De Bruyne scores superb second-half equaliser to earn Man City draw in first leg
Vinicius had put Real Madrid in front with stunning 25-yard strike before half-time
Second leg at Etihad Stadium on Wednesday, 17 May
Winner will face Inter or AC Milan in final in Istanbul on 10 June

HT: Real Madrid 1-0 Man City
Real Madrid have scored a goal after taking just one shot in the first half of a Champions League match for the first time since at least the 2003-04 season according to our friends at Opta.
